Northwest Natural Holding’s 1.67% decline on the latest session occurred against a backdrop of mixed volume patterns. Trading volume appeared elevated relative to recent averages, suggesting increased conviction behind the move. As a regulated natural gas utility, NWN is often influenced by changes in long-term interest rate expectations, which affect the relative appeal of dividend-paying stocks. The broader utility sector has faced headwinds from rising Treasury yields, which may have contributed to profit-taking in names like NWN. Additionally, the company’s operations are tied to seasonal demand patterns; with the winter heating season winding down, some investors could be adjusting positions ahead of lower demand periods. Regulatory developments in Oregon and Washington, where NWN operates, also remain a focus, as rate case outcomes can materially affect earnings growth. The stock’s underperformance compared to the broader market this session suggests that company-specific factors—such as its exposure to natural gas price volatility or capital expenditure plans—may be weighing on sentiment. While the utility provides essential services, its earnings sensitivity to weather and commodity prices adds an element of uncertainty that the market appears to be pricing in. From a technical perspective, NWN’s decline brings it closer to its key support level at $46.97, a price zone that has historically attracted buying interest. The stock is currently trading below its 50-day moving average, which may be acting as near-term resistance in the $50–$51 area. The relative strength index (RSI) is in the low-to-mid 40s, indicating bearish momentum but not yet oversold territory.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) line appears to have crossed below its signal line, suggesting developing negative momentum. The price action over the past several sessions has formed a series of lower highs and lower lows, consistent with a short-term downtrend. Volume on down days has generally exceeded volume on up days, confirming institutional distribution in the name. The resistance at $51.91 represents a level where the stock has previously stalled, marking the top of a likely trading range. If NWN continues to hold above support, a base-building pattern may emerge. However, the current technical picture suggests that sellers remain in control until the stock can reclaim the moving average area. Looking ahead, Northwest Natural Holding’s ability to sustain its support at $46.97 will be critical. A bounce from that level could potentially lead to a recovery toward the $51.91 resistance, especially if utility sector sentiment improves or if interest rates stabilize. Conversely, a break below $46.97 could open the door to further downside, with the next major support area potentially near $45.00 or lower, depending on broader market conditions. Factors that may influence future performance include upcoming earnings reports, which could provide clarity on customer growth, rate case outcomes, and capital allocation plans. Changes in natural gas prices—particularly if volatility increases—could also affect investor perception of earnings stability. Additionally, Federal Reserve policy signals regarding interest rates remain a key external driver; any shift toward a less hawkish stance could benefit rate-sensitive utilities like NWN. Traders and investors should monitor volume closely around the support level, as a high-volume breakdown would carry more significance than a low-volume drift.
